Vitess解析0 码力 | 21 页 | 926.63 KB | 2 年前3
The Vitess 6.0 Documentation0 码力 | 210 页 | 846.79 KB | 2 年前3
高性能 Kubernetes 元数据存储 KubeBrain 的设计思路和落地效果-许辰加汪 mp av 本本 邮生 revision3 所 range 分片。 于宁5全为 1. 底层 ByteKV 全局有序,无论是点查还是范 围查询,均非常友好 2. 避免了热点 key 的产生 3. 对用户 key 进行编码,保证编码前后顺序不 变 读 本到 配忆 多损与 multi raft range 分片,增大写并发 Brain 层无磁盘 io,只有网络 io 写优化 - 3 事务优化 精心设计 key 格式 一个 k8s 对象的索引和数据在同一分区内 跨分区分布式事务 -> 分区内单机事务 读优化 - 1 Range 读 Unary -> Stream 代替分页,降低延迟 ee 读优化 - 2 多分片并发读 通过并发,大大减少读时延 读优化 架构 2 中进 。 目前所有消息严格要求有序 。 消息不重不丢、严格有序,所以写必须单点 。Kubernetes 本质是一个最终一致性的系统 。 关注单个对象的最终状态 。 分片多点写,避免写单点 , 分片内部消息严格有序 届分请间消息可以乱序 。, 读、写、watch 能力均可以水平扩展 充 欢迎 尝 联系邮箱: xuchen.xiaoying@bytedance0 码力 | 60 页 | 8.02 MB | 2 年前3
[PingCAP Meetup SH 5.26]上海电信微信营业厅 TiDB 实践 v 1.6五月追剧热点,我来告诉你! 2 天翼手机节 报价不玩虚! 0 ## 欧罗达 套餐·余额 我的服务 我要办理 ## 业务痛点 运维 中间件 稳定性 ## 选择 MyCat TIDB Mysql 分片 ## 选型测试 Mysql 主从分表:活动 延迟 Mycat:进行过 100 张分表处理,复杂度、可维护性高 TIDB:进行生产数据导入和实时同步进行数据测试。当时 beta 版本 ## 上线0 码力 | 9 页 | 188.20 KB | 1 年前3
The Vitess 5.0 Documentation0 码力 | 206 页 | 875.06 KB | 2 年前3
The Vitess 11.0 Documentation0 码力 | 481 页 | 3.14 MB | 2 年前3
Using MySQL for Distributed Database Architectures0 码力 | 67 页 | 4.10 MB | 1 年前3
孟浩然-Apache ShardingSphere 架构解析&应用实践|功能|提供基础功能|提供基础设施和最佳实践| |驱动方式|配置文件|标准 DistSQL| |耦合|耦合较大,存在功能依赖|相互隔离,互无感知| |组合方式|固定的组合方式:以数据分片为基础,叠加读写分离和数据加密等功能|自由的组合方式:数据分片、读写分离和数据加密等功能自由组合使用| ## 产品架构 应用端 ShardingSphere-JDBC JAVA/轻量/高性能 代理端 ShardingSphere-Proxy 采用无中心化架构,与应用程序共享资源,适用于 Java 开发的高性能的轻量级 OLTP 应用; - ShardingSphere-Proxy 提供静态入口以及异构语言的支持,独立于应用程序部署,适用于 OLAP 应用以及对分片数据库进行管理和运维的场景。 ## 整体架构 ## 连接 连接数据和应用,关注多模数据库之间的合作 ## 增量 通过数据库入口流量的抓取提供透明化的增量功能 ## 可插拔 微内核完全面向可插拔的三层架构体系设计 c4fabf401b4b57/p9_3.jpg) ## 增量 增量是 ShardingSphere 的主要能力,在拦截访问数据库流量的前提下,透明化的提供增量功能。增强包含了流量的重定向(数据分片、读写分离、影子库)、流量变形(数据加密)、流量鉴权(SQL 审计、权限)、流量治理(熔断、限流)以及流量分析(可观察性、服务质量分析)等。 , "name": "jack" 7c953b2ad2dd5a93b7dc04a5e4d/p5_1.jpg) ## 主要内容 • 如何保证数据高可靠? • 如何保证服务高可用? • 如何实现水平扩展? 单节点 复制集 分片集群 ## 单节点 Client Client  ## Proxy分片 Client 












